specific Testing: Extending Battery Lifespan and Minimizing useful resource Depletion

by far the most immediate strategy to lessen the environmental influence of EV batteries is To optimize their services everyday living. A battery that lasts lengthier implies much less new batteries must be created, right cutting down on the intense mining of Uncooked materials like lithium, cobalt, and nickel. This is where precision testing will become indispensable.

modern-day battery testing techniques are intended to complete refined cost-discharge cycles on a big selection of battery chemistries, including lead-acid, lithium-ion, and nickel-metallic hydride. By making use of meticulous control more than voltage, present, and temperature for the duration of these cycles, the tools can accurately evaluate a battery's state of wellbeing (SoH) and point out of charge (SoC). This can be excess of a simple pass-fall short Test. It requires mapping the battery's potential degradation curve and identifying early indications of efficiency decay, such as amplified interior resistance or lowered coulombic performance.

With this comprehensive diagnostic info, manufacturers and service facilities can implement qualified maintenance methods. For example, a slight imbalance in between cells may be recognized and corrected via precise rebalancing cycles, avoiding a cascade failure that may if not render the entire pack unusable. This proactive solution substantially slows down the normal degradation procedure, extending the battery’s primary operational lifestyle throughout the car or truck. Therefore, the necessity for untimely and costly battery replacements is greatly decreased, conserving wide quantities of resources and Electricity that may are actually eaten from the manufacturing of a whole new unit.

Enabling Second-Life programs: The Cornerstone of the round financial state

An EV battery is usually deemed at the end of its automotive daily life when its capability drops to all around 70-eighty% of its primary rating. at this stage, it may possibly no longer deliver the selection and performance envisioned by motorists. nevertheless, it is way from currently being waste. These retired batteries keep sizeable potential, building them suitable candidates for a lot less demanding, stationary purposes.

This is where the principle of a round overall economy concerns everyday living. A reputable testing process would be the critical gatekeeper for 2nd-everyday living apps. prior to a battery pack is often repurposed for an Electricity storage method (ESS) to help a photo voltaic farm, a business developing, or a home grid, it have to undergo rigorous evaluation. The check technique will have to confirm its remaining capability, its capability to handle unique cost and discharge premiums securely, and its General stability. This evaluation is important for grading the batteries and certifying them for his or her new position, ensuring each basic safety and performance.

By facilitating this changeover from automotive use to stationary storage, brands can generate new profits streams from what was once regarded as a legal responsibility. additional importantly, it radically extends the helpful life of the battery's core materials, delaying the need for recycling and preventing the landfill. This practice reduces the accumulation of Digital waste and lessens the market’s dependence on a fragile and sometimes environmentally taxing world source chain For brand new minerals.

Optimizing the Recycling system: Maximizing Resource Restoration effectiveness

whenever a battery is no longer practical for even 2nd-existence programs, recycling becomes the final action in closing the loop. helpful recycling is about recovering the utmost quantity of valuable supplies, like cobalt, lithium, and copper, to be used in new batteries. The effectiveness of this method is closely depending on the quality of data out there with regards to the battery.

State-of-the-art screening methods Perform a pivotal role right here by performing as a knowledge logger through the entire battery's lifetime. The in-depth heritage recorded—like chemistry sort, general performance degradation designs, and mobile-degree well being—presents recyclers with a comprehensive profile of each battery pack. This facts allows for simpler sorting and pre-processing. Instead of managing each individual battery as a black box, recyclers can segregate them based on their chemical make-up and condition.

This data-pushed solution enables the selection of essentially the most suitable recycling approach, whether it is a large-temperature pyrometallurgical system or a far more qualified hydrometallurgical system that uses liquids to dissolve and different metals. Precise sorting and system assortment lead to higher Restoration costs and increased purity from the reclaimed elements. This, subsequently, reduces the Electrical power and chemical usage of your recycling procedure alone, reducing its environmental footprint and building recycled supplies a far more economically practical option to newly mined ones.

information-Driven conclusion creating: The Path to smart Management

The transition to market four.0 is predicated on using data to travel effectiveness and innovation. EV battery tests techniques are no more isolated pieces of hardware; These are intelligent information hubs that integrate seamlessly into a sensible manufacturing unit ecosystem.

These methods supply true-time monitoring of every battery beneath check, with facts available remotely through centralized program platforms. This continuous stream of information permits engineers and professionals to investigate general performance tendencies, recognize prospective bottlenecks within the production line, and optimize battery conditioning protocols. one example is, if details Assessment reveals a consistent sample of untimely cell failure in a selected batch, it might be traced again to a certain producing stage or product supplier, letting for quick corrective action.

This amount of Perception facilitates predictive maintenance, enhances good quality control, and enhances Total operational efficiency. By leveraging information analytics, producers can refine their battery types, make improvements to output yields, and develop more effective guarantee and repair tactics. This clever management technique not merely decreases costs and squander and also accelerates the educational curve, driving ongoing improvement and innovation across the complete Group.
